Main information about car part LEXUS 4333039855
Producer LEXUS
Number 4333039855
Group Ball Joint
Description Ball Joint
Tie Rod End
Analogue of LEXUS 4333039855
A.B.S. A.B.S. 220310 220310 Ball Joint
BLUE PRINT BLUE PRINT ADT386190 ADT386190 Ball Joint
DODA DODA 1060230031 1060230031 Tie Rod End
FEBI BILSTEIN FEBI BILSTEIN 43076 43076 Ball Joint
FORMPART FORMPART 4204060 4204060 Ball Joint
KAVO PARTS KAVO PARTS SBJ-9047 SBJ9047 Ball Joint
LYNXAUTO LYNXAUTO C1313R C1313R Ball Joint
NK NK 5044548 5044548 Ball Joint
PROFIT PROFIT 2301-0411 23010411 Ball Joint
STELLOX STELLOX 52-98037A-SX 5298037ASX Tie Rod End
STELLOX STELLOX 52-98037-SX 5298037SX Ball Joint
SWAG SWAG 81 94 3076 81943076 Ball Joint
TRISCAN TRISCAN 8500 135009 8500135009 Tie Rod End
TRW TRW JBJ7630 JBJ7630 Ball Joint
ZEKKERT ZEKKERT TG-5215 TG5215 Tie Rod End
The other parts with the same number "4333039855"
TOYOTA 43330-39855 Ball Joint